Mahinda Rajapaksa clinches landslide win in Kurunegala
Mobitel inner 1278

Prime Minister Mahinda Rajapaksa of Sri Lanka Podujana Peramuna (SLPP) is leading the preferential votes in Kurunegala District with a whopping 527,364 votes.

 

Sri Lanka Podujana Peramuna (SLPP) clinched the highest number of votes from this electoral district which added up to 649,965 (66.92%). Accordingly, the SLPP has managed to claim 11 seats.

 

In the meantime, the Samagi Jana Balawegaya (SJB) claimed 04 seats, with 244,860 votes (25.21%).

 

Jathika Jana Balawegaya (JJB) was the third with 36,290 votes (2.81%) while the United National Party (UNP) obtained 26,770 votes (2.76%) in the fourth place.

 

SLPP – 11

 

Mahinda Rajapaksa – 527,364
Johnston Fernando – 199,203
Gunapala Rathnasekara – 141,991
Dayasiri Jayasekara – 112,452
Asanka Nawaratne – 82,779
Samanpriya Herath – 66,814
D.B. Herath – 61,954
Anura Priyadarshana Yapa – 59,696
Jayaratne Herath – 54,351
Shantha Bandara – 52,086
Sumith Udukumbura – 51,134

 


SJB – 04

 

Nalin Bandara – 75,631
J.C. Alawathuwala – 65,956
Ashok Abeysinghe – 54,512
Thushara Indunil – 49,364
